Role Summary We seek an accomplished Manager – Data Modeling to lead enterprise‑grade data modeling and information architecture for our insurance portfolio, with preference for specialty lines experience. You will define conceptual, logical, and physical models; standardize data across core domains; partner with underwriting, claims, actuarial, finance, and engineering; and enable analytics/AI use cases that drive measurable business value. Key Responsibilities 1) Strategy & Architecture Own the data modeling strategy across the insurance value chain (underwriting, rating, policy admin, claims, billing, reinsurance, finance, distribution). Define and maintain enterprise conceptual, logical, and physical models and canonical structures ; align to business and digital roadmaps. Shape target‑state DWH/lakehouse/semantic architectures and integration patterns with core platforms and data products. 2) Data Modeling & Design Design robust models for specialty products (e.g., E&O, D&O, Cyber, Marine, Aviation, Umbrella), including risk/exposure, coverage, limits, locations, modifiers . Deliver models for rating engines, pricing analytics, and actuarial studies ; implement 3NF, dimensional/star‑schema, data vault , and wide‑table patterns as appropriate. Create semantic layers and curated data products that accelerate BI and data science. 3) Governance, Quality & Standards Establish standards, naming conventions, conformed dimensions , and model versioning/release practices. Partner with Data Governance on glossary, metadata, lineage, access controls , and data quality rules/scorecards ; chair or co‑chair the Design Authority for models. 4) Delivery & Change Leadership Lead modeling for migrations and platform modernizations , including data harmonization across legacy and target cores. Guide engineering teams implementing models on cloud platforms (Azure/AWS/GCP) and modern lakehouse stacks; ensure performance, partitioning, and cost efficiency. Enable UAT/SIT for data products, manage risks (DQ, integration complexity, technical debt), and ensure on‑time, on‑budget delivery. 5) Stakeholder & People Leadership Engage senior stakeholders (underwriting, claims, actuarial, finance, technology) to prioritize use‑cases and value outcomes. Lead and mentor a team of data modelers/analysts (5–10+) ; build accelerators/playbooks and capability uplift. Communicate complex topics clearly to executive and non‑technical audiences; manage vendors/SIs where required. Required Experience & Skills Experience (must meet all minimums) 8+ years total in Data & Analytics. 5+ years in data modeling/information architecture/data design . 5+ years in the insurance domain . 5+ years working with or supporting specialty lines (preferred). 4+ years in leadership/people management , owning modeling workstreams and mentoring teams. 3+ years working with insurance core systems (e.g., Guidewire, Duck Creek, Majesco/Insurity, or equivalent). Technical Skills Expert in conceptual, logical, physical modeling; dimensional/star/snowflake , data vault , temporal/versioned data design. Strong SQL and proficiency Implementation experience on Azure/AWS/GCP and lakehouse paradigms (e.g., Delta/Iceberg); performance tuning, partitioning, indexing. Working knowledge of ETL/ELT (ADF, Glue, Talend, Fivetran, Airflow), semantic layers/BI (Power BI/Tableau/Looker), and MDM concepts. Domain Skills Deep understanding of policy lifecycle , coverages/endorsements , exposures/locations , claims & reserves , reinsurance (treaty/fac) , broker/bordereaux/distribution , and financial data flows . Ability to translate underwriting, actuarial, and claims requirements into scalable data designs and analytics‑ready structures. Proven experience in data standards, glossary, lineage and DQ rulebooks . Leadership & Consulting Skills Executive presence; structured storytelling and documentation. Stakeholder management across business and technology; design authority facilitation. Team development, workload planning, and delivery governance in Agile/hybrid models. Preferred Qualifications Specialty lines depth (e.g., Cyber, Marine, Energy, Financial Lines, E&S). Cloud certifications (Azure/AWS/GCP); experience with governance platforms (Collibra, Alation, Atlan, Purview). Experience with rating engines and underwriting workbenches .
